Basically the only problem I had with this place is that breakfast was awful. Otherwise, we enjoyed our stay. The room was clean and comfortable. I slept well, and I almost always have trouble sleeping in hotels. We were even pleasantly surprised to find that the TV had a USB port that we could use to charge our phones. The water pressure in the shower was good(after I got my husband to change the setting on the shower head that I’m too short to reach – DON’T LAUGH), there were plenty of towels, and the toiletries were pleasant. There is plenty of parking and the Metro station is a short walk or shuttle ride away. The breakfast sucked. There was generically flavored mixed fruit, which is mixed fruit that looks fresh but tastes like nothing. There are waffle irons that don’t get your waffle crispy(although there is a really nice variety of toppings for those waffles). There are pastries that tasted stale and flavorless. The hot options are a meat and an egg. Being vegetarian, I usually rely on the eggs to give me some much-needed protein at a hotel breakfast, because it’s often one of the few options I have(even the yogurt cups have gelatin in them!). But both mornings that we ate here, the eggs had meat in them. One morning, it was omelets with peppers and ham; the next it was scrambled eggs with pieces of sausage. What gives? Since there’s already a meat dish, why not just let people decide for themselves if they want to eat meat and eggs together, instead of mixing them and ensuring some folks can’t eat it? I ate the little cups of peanut butter; it was the only thing I had left.

My family and I absolutely loved this hotel! The location is about 20 minutes away from downtown DC via metro and the station is right around the corner from the hotel and the shuttle service is awesome. We just come down and they will drop you off or call on your way home and they will be waiting for you. The shuttle is 100% free but tips are appreciated. The hotel itself is modern, beautiful, and definitely energy efficient. The common area is large and the staff is very very friendly. The pool is heated with a lifeguard on duty at all times. The gym is very nice with new equipment, free weights, medicine balls, a TV and more. Every morning we woke up to an awesome free breakfast with a waffle bar, bakery goods, eggs, bacon, sausage, juices, cereal, oatmeal, etc. They also packed breakfasts to-go at the front desk in case you are on the run. They have a 24 coffee and tea bar that is always looked after. 24 hour sweet shop/convince counter and business center. I would only stay at Hampton inns if they were all like this. Warm cookies every night, kind staff, and comfy beds. Loved this hotel!
